An electrical resistance heating element for a heating device, with at least one flow canal through which the gaseous medium is able to flow from a canal inlet side to a canal outlet side of the resistance heating element, and with at least one heating resistor that extends essentially in the direction of the flow canal, with the medium flowing past the heating resistor and being heated in the process. The heating resistor is rod-shaped and produced from an electrically conductive ceramic material. The electrical resistance heating element is intended for installation in a heating tube into which air, for example, is blown at one end. The heated flow of air exits from the other end of the heating tube.
